// # Copyright 2009 Community Shopper, Inc.
// Place your application-specific JavaScript functions and classes here
// This file is automatically included by javascript_include_tag :defaults
	$(document).ready(function(){

			$('form.form-large').each(function(){
				$('input[type!=checkbox]',this).focus(function(){
				$(this).removeClass('form-text').addClass('form-text-selected');
				});
				$('input[type!=checkbox]',this).blur(function(){
				$(this).removeClass('form-text-selected').addClass('form-text');
				});
			});

			
			//Setup vendor specific pages
			 if ( $('#vendor-top').length  ){
			 $('#contents').css('background','url(/images/bottom-wrapper-sponsored.png) no-repeat left bottom');
			 $('#wrapper').css('background','url(/images/login-clip-top.png) no-repeat left top');
			 $('#middle-vendor-nav').css('display','block');
			 $('#middle-join-now').css('display','none');
			 }else{
			 	if($('#search-results').length){
					 $('#contents').css('background','url(/images/bottom-wrapper-sponsored.png) no-repeat left bottom');
					 $('#wrapper').css('background','url(/images/login-clip-top.png) no-repeat left top');				
				}else{
				 $('#middle-join-now').css('display','block');
				 $('#middle-vendor-nav').css('display','none');
				 $('.vendor-only').css('display', 'none');}
			 }		
			 
				if($('#middle-join-now').length){
						var middleCount= 0;
						var expandMiddleBy = 1;
						$('div.offer-middle').each(function(){
							//$(this.attr('id')+'_complete')
							middleCount = middleCount +1;
						});	
						if(middleCount%2)
						{expandMiddleBy = expandMiddleBy+(middleCount -1) / 2;;}	
						else	
						{expandMiddleBy = expandMiddleBy+(middleCount  / 2) -1;;}		
						middleHeight = 400+((expandMiddleBy-1)*350)+'px';
						$('#middle-join-now').css('height',middleHeight);
				}	
				//if(jQuery.support.leadingWhitespace == false)
				//{$('#container').css('display', 'none'); alert('Please use Firefox, Safari, or Chrome'); }				
	});

// needs formatted
 	function cart(percentdiv, heatdiv, cartid) {
		$(document).ready(function(){      
				$(heatdiv).each(function(){
					//$(this.attr('id')+'_complete')
					if($(percentdiv).text() != 100){
						var percentComplete = $(percentdiv).text()/100; 
							$(cartid).css({marginLeft: '4px', marginTop:'5px'}).animate({marginLeft:((256-53)*percentComplete)+'px'},4000,'easeOutBounce');
					}else{
						//console.log($(cartid).src);
						$(cartid).attr("src","/images/cart-ppl-100.png");
						$(cartid).css({marginLeft: '75px', marginTop:'-18px'})
						//$(cartid).src = '/images/cart-ppl-100.png';
					}
				});
				});  
			}
//Preloading function from dreamweaver
		function MM_preloadImages() { //v3.0
		  var d=document; if(d.images){ if(!d.MM_p) d.MM_p=new Array();
			var i,j=d.MM_p.length,a=MM_preloadImages.arguments; for(i=0; i<a.length; i++)
			if (a[i].indexOf("#")!=0){ d.MM_p[j]=new Image; d.MM_p[j++].src=a[i];}}
		}


